Privacy, Scams, and Verification Best Practices
Unsolicited messages claiming to involve Todd Chrisley, especially those requesting payments, personal data, or promising exclusive access, should be treated with caution. Verify outreach through multiple official indicators, such as authenticated accounts, domain ownership, and prior public announcements before taking action.
